Sky (SKY) is the governance token of Sky Protocol and an upgraded version of MakerDAO, built to make DeFi more accessible, scalable, and rewarding through modular, non-custodial tools.

It utilizes Proof of SQL, a sub-second ZK coprocessor, which allows smart contracts, AI agents, and on-chain applications to efficiently query both on-chain and off-chain data at scale, while ensuring the accuracy of results through cryptographic proofs. This technology enables secure, scalable, and trustless data access across decentralized ecosystems.
